All counters and cabinets should be designed for working comfort. Counters should be 34 to 36 inches high, and wall cabinets should begin 16 to 18 inches above the counter. Counter tops may be in a variety of materials—stainless steel near the sink, wood in the form of a chopping block for food preparation, serviceable plastic laminates in a variety of colors and patterns, and decorative ceramic tile, mosaic, or marble. Cabinets may be constructed of wood or steel with the door fronts finished in a variety of ways —paint, stain, or plastic laminates. Floor, walls, and ceiling may be covered in vinyl. |
